- PRArcher to Shape Physical AI Future of Aerospace and Defense with Acquisition of Boeing’s Wisk Aero, Insitu and SkyGrid Subsidiaries; Boeing to Invest in Archer and CollaborateTransaction creates an end-to-end physical AI platform for aerospace and defense. Adds a profitable defense business generating over $200M in annual revenue[1], with operations across 35 countries, to Archer’s portfolio. Combines Wisk, SkyGrid and Insitu’s pioneering autonomy and airspace intelligence software with Archer’s leading purpose-built AI foundation model for aerospace and defense, ZEE. Boeing to take stake and become a strategic partner to Archer; establishes ongoing Archer and Boeing collaboration and technology sharing arrangement. - PRSomon Air Receives Its First Boeing 737 MAX Jet- Tajikistan's national carrier to modernize its fleet and expand its network with the 737-8- 737 MAX to complement the Central Asian airline's planned 787 Dreamliner fleetDUSHANBE, Tajikistan, Aug. 3,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Boeing (NYSE:BA) and Somon Air today announced the delivery of the airline's first 737 MAX, as the Tajik national carrier continues to modernize its fleet and grow its network. The 737-8 is the first of two airplanes leased from Dubai Aerospace Enterprise (DAE) to be delivered and represents the first 737 MAX in Tajikistan. - PRAerCap Orders 15 787 Dreamliner Jets to Meet High DemandAerCap is the world's largest owner of 787 Dreamliner jetsAgreement includes substitution rights for the 787-10, giving AerCap customers more capacity and operational flexibilityFARNBOROUGH, United Kingdom, July 21,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Boeing (NYSE:BA) and AerCap today announced that the leasing industry's biggest 787 Dreamliner customer placed a new order for 15 787-9 jets. This latest purchase increases AerCap's 787 Dreamliner portfolio to approximately 140 airplanes. - PRSMBC Aviation Capital Orders 100 Boeing 737 MAX JetsAgreement includes SMBC Aviation Capital's first-ever 737-10 order737-10 order is single largest by a lessorFARNBOROUGH, United Kingdom, July 20,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Boeing (NYSE:BA) and SMBC Aviation Capital today announced that the global aviation finance platform and lessor has ordered 100 737 MAX airplanes, including 60 737-10 and 40 737-8 jets. The 737-10 order represents SMBC Aviation Capital's first purchase for the 737 MAX family's highest capacity variant. 6 questionsWhat does Boeing Company do?
The Boeing Company,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, manufactures, sales, services, and supports commercial jetliners, military aircraft, satellites, missile defense, human space flight and launch systems, and services wor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Commercial Airplanes; Defense, Space & Security; Global Services; and Boeing Capital. The Commercial Airplanes segment provides commercial jet aircraft for passenger and cargo requirements, as well as fleet support services.
